Hunter Schafer: Full Biography and Professional Profile

Hunter Schafer is an American actress, model, and LGBTQ+ rights activist who rose to global prominence with her breakout role on HBO's *Euphoria*. Her career trajectory has quickly established her as a fashion icon and a formidable dramatic talent.

  • Full Name: Hunter Schafer
  • Date of Birth: December 31, 1998
  • Place of Birth: Raleigh, North Carolina, U.S.
  • Nationality: American
  • Occupation: Actress, Model, Artist, Activist
  • Activism: She is a prominent transgender rights advocate, having been a plaintiff in the ACLU's lawsuit against North Carolina's HB2 (the "bathroom bill"). She was named to *Teen Vogue's* "21 Under 21" list in 2017.
  • Breakout Role: Jules Vaughn in the HBO series *Euphoria* (2019–present).
  • Major Film Roles:
    • *The Hunger Games: The Ballad of Songbirds & Snakes* (2023) as Tigris Snow.
    • *Cuckoo* (2024)
    • *Kinds of Kindness* (2024)
  • Upcoming Projects: *Mother Mary* and the highly anticipated series *Blade Runner 2099*.

The Official Cast: Who is Playing Princess Zelda and Link?

In a major announcement in mid-2025, Nintendo and the production team officially revealed the actors set to take on the iconic roles of Link and Princess Zelda, confirming that the fan-casting of Hunter Schafer would not come to fruition for this iteration of the film.

The Official Cast Lineup:

  • Princess Zelda: Bo Bragason
  • Link: Benjamin Evan Ainsworth

The casting of Bo Bragason as Princess Zelda and Benjamin Evan Ainsworth as Link signals a clear direction for director Wes Ball’s vision. This choice anchors the film with a younger, internationally-led cast, suggesting the narrative may focus on a coming-of-age adventure, potentially drawing inspiration from the youthful portrayals of the characters in games like *Ocarina of Time* or *The Wind Waker*.

Bo Bragason, while perhaps less globally recognized than Schafer, brings a fresh face and a sense of discovery to the role, a move that often appeals to studios adapting beloved video game properties. This decision to cast a less-established star for the lead roles in the *Legend of Zelda* movie, rather than relying on a high-profile name like Hunter Schafer, is a common strategy to ensure the actor's persona does not overshadow the iconic character they are portraying.
